Weighted GPA Calculator (5.0 Scale)
A weighted GPA rewards you for taking harder classes. Honors courses typically add +0.5 grade points and AP or IB courses add +1.0, letting an A in an AP class count as a 5.0. Choose a course type for each class below and your weighted GPA updates in real time.
- Honors (+0.5) and AP/IB (+1.0) course weighting
- GPA ceiling of 5.0 — an A in an AP class counts as 5.0
- F grades never earn bonus points, matching real transcript rules

Weighted 5.0 Scale grade point values
| Letter Grade | Grade Points |
|---|---|
| A | 4.0 |
| A- | 3.7 |
| B+ | 3.3 |
| B | 3.0 |
| B- | 2.7 |
| C+ | 2.3 |
| C | 2.0 |
| C- | 1.7 |
| D+ | 1.3 |
| D | 1.0 |
| F | 0.0 |
Honors courses add +0.5 and AP/IB courses add +1.0 to the values above, up to the 5.0 ceiling.
